Jānis Sperga

Researcher at pureLiFi

Jānis Sperga has been working in the field of research since 2014. Jānis began their career at the Institute of Solid State Physics, University of Latvia (ISSP UL), where they completed their Bachelor Thesis. In 2018, they moved to the University of Erlangen-Nuremberg, where they worked as a Research Assistant. In this role, they conducted research on the phase and polarization sensitive optical properties of Ge nanohelices, including sample preparation, interferometry measurements, photoluminescence measurements, data analysis, and theoretical interpretation of the measurement results. Jānis also provided introductory training and supervision for new master students and supervised an electronics lab course for bachelor students. In 2020, Jānis moved to pureLiFi Ltd as a Researcher. Finally, in 2022, they began a Visiting Researcher role at The University of Edinburgh.

Jānis Sperga began their educational journey in 2013, when they earned a Bachelor of Science degree in Physics from Latvijas Universitate. Jānis then continued their studies at FAU Erlangen-Nürnberg, where they obtained a Master of Science degree in Materials Physics in 2019. Currently, Jānis is pursuing a Doctor of Philosophy degree in Electrical and Electronics Engineering at the University of Strathclyde, which they are expected to complete in 2023.
